Xabi Alonso may have uncovered the next Florian Wirtz, and he's already a Real Madrid player.

Just last month, Liverpool sent shockwaves across all of football after they announced that they had signed Bayer Leverkusen star Wirtz for a club record fee of a guaranteed £100m plus a further £16m in add-ons.

The German international attracted interest from several of the top clubs in Europe, including both Bayern Munich and Real Madrid, but ultimately opted to pen a five-year deal with the Reds.

Since then, both Bayern Munich and Real Madrid have been forced to consider alternative options to the talented midfielder, a difficult task given the fact that they have both been competing in the ongoing Club World Cup.

Advert

But it appears that Real's busy schedule at the competition may have come as a blessing in disguise, as it has allowed Alonso to uncover a player who could be the next Wirtz.

Despite the fact that Real exited the Club World Cup in embarrassing fashion following a crushing 4-0 defeat to Paris Saint-Germain, the competition has allowed Alonso to get used to his new team.

And in doing so, the Spaniard has realised just how talented young midfielder Arda Guler truly is, identifying him as someone who could fulfil the role that Wirtz played in Alonso's Bayer Leverkusen squad.

As pointed out in a report by TotalFootballAnalysis, Alonso has deployed Guler in several different roles during the Club World Cup, figuring out exactly how the Turkish international fits into his team.

Against Juventus, the 20-year-old played as an invered winger while against Dortmund he played in a double pivot alongside Aurelien Tchouameni.

On both occasions, the youngster stood out as one of the best players on the pitch, demonstrating that, like Wirtz, he is capable of receiving and pass the ball quickly at impressive ranges while also creating chances for his teammates.

Although Real boast several of the world's best midfielders, including the likes of Jude Bellingham and Federico Valverde, none better fit the role that Wirtz played for Alonso's at his previous club than Guler.

Wirtz made 119 appearances for Alonso, and therefore leaves big shoes to fill, but Guler can replicate the tactical flexibility that the German gave Alonso at Leverkusen, and therefore we could see him become a regular part of the Real Madrid team next season.
